α-Hydroxybutyrate Dehydrogenase Assay Kit (α-Ketobutyrate Substrate Method)
The kit consists of two main reagents: Reagent 1 contains reduced nicotinamide adenine dinucleotide (NADH), and Reagent 2 includes a phosphate buffer (pH 7.5) and α-ketobutyrate. These components are essential for the accurate measurement of α-hydroxybutyrate dehydrogenase activity in human serum.

Intended Use:
This kit is designed for the in vitro quantitative determination of α-hydroxybutyrate dehydrogenase (α-HBDH) activity in human serum. It is widely used in clinical laboratories to assess cardiac and liver function, as α-HBDH levels are indicative of tissue damage.

Clinical Applications

The α-Hydroxybutyrate Dehydrogenase Assay Kit is primarily used in clinical settings to assess cardiac and liver function. It is a critical tool in diagnosing and monitoring tissue damage, particularly in patients with heart or liver conditions.

1. Cardiac Assessment: The kit is used to measure α-HBDH levels in patients suspected of myocardial infarction, helping to confirm the diagnosis and monitor recovery.
2. Liver Function: Elevated α-HBDH levels can indicate liver damage, making this kit useful in diagnosing and managing liver diseases.
